Klaus Steiner (born October 7, 1953 in Übersee in Chiemgau ) is a German politician ( CSU ). He has been a member of the Bavarian State Parliament since 2008 .

Life

Steiner attended secondary school in Traunstein from 1969 to 1973 and then completed an internship and basic military service until 1974 . From 1975 to 1978 he completed his studies at the civil service college and then worked until 1978 as a judicial officer at the district court of Traunstein and at the Munich public prosecutor's office . He then worked as an advisor to the CSU parliamentary group until 2003 and then until 2008 as a personal advisor to the president of the state parliament .

He is married and has three children.

politics

Steiner joined the Junge Union and the CSU in 1970 and later became the party's local chairman. He has been CSU district chairman in the Traunstein district since 2003 . Since 20 October 2008 he is a member of the state parliament in Bavaria . There he is both a member of the Committee on Food, Agriculture and Forestry and a member of the Committee on Education, Youth and Sport . He represents the constituency of Traunstein ( constituency of Upper Bavaria ) in the state parliament. At the end of 2008 he succeeded Anton Kern, who had left the state parliament at the time, as chairman of the prison advisory board of the Laufen-Lebenau prison. Steiner is currently a member of the Committee for Environment and Consumer Protection.
